MD5加密算法,即"Message-Digest Algorithm 5(信息-摘要算法)",它由MD2、MD3、MD4发展而来的一种单向函数算法(也就是HASH算法),它是国际著名的公钥加密算法标准RSA的第一设计者R.Rivest于上个世纪90年代初开发出来的。MD5的最大作用在于,将不同格式的 ...
分类:
其他好文 时间:
2016-06-12 23:15:20
阅读次数:
145
加密算法介绍: 对称加密: DES:date encrption standard,56bit 3DES: AES: Advanced AES192,AES256,AES512 Blowfish 单向加密 MD4,MD5 SHA1, SHA192,SHA256,SHA384 CR3-32 公钥加密: ...
分类:
其他好文 时间:
2016-06-01 06:44:50
阅读次数:
191
一、哈希算法验证数据完整性可以用哈希算法。对发送数据和接收数据的哈希值进行比对,如果一致,证明接收数据与发送数据一致,及数据完整。SDK提供了哈希算法有关的API,支持MD2、MD4、MD5、SHA-1、SHA224、SHA256、SHA384、SHA512算法。方法声明在
举例:MD5算法API使用方法
MD5加密,结果为32位十六...
分类:
编程语言 时间:
2016-05-13 03:40:53
阅读次数:
210
Delphi版的Base64转换函数(修改版)重新组织编写Delphi的MD2、MD4、MD5类
MD5的全称是Message-Digest Algorithm 5,在90年代初由MIT的计算机科学实验室和RSA Data Security Inc发明,经MD2、MD3和MD4发展而来。 MD5将任意长度的“字节串”变换成一个128bit的大整数,并且它是一个不可逆的字符串变换算法,换句话说就....
分类:
编程语言 时间:
2015-12-28 18:21:24
阅读次数:
247
MD5即Message-DigestAlgorithm5(信息-摘要算法5),用于确保信息传输完整一致。是计算机广泛使用的杂凑算法之一(又译摘要算法、哈希算法),主流编程语言普遍已有MD5实现。将数据(如汉字)运算为另一固定长度值,是杂凑算法的基础原理,MD5的前身有MD2、MD3和MD4。md5散列一..
分类:
其他好文 时间:
2015-11-29 06:55:44
阅读次数:
152
MD5的全称是Message-Digest Algorithm 5,在90年代初由MIT的计算机科学实验室和RSA Data Security Inc发明,经MD2、MD3和MD4发展而来。 MD5将任意长度的“字节串”变换成一个128bit的大整数,并且它是一个不可逆的字符串变换算法,换句话...
分类:
编程语言 时间:
2015-11-21 13:09:05
阅读次数:
265
1. EAP类型: EAP-PEAP, EAP-TLS, EAP-TTLS, EAP-MD5TLS需要客户端服务器端都有证书; 而PEAP和TTLS只需要服务器端证书.2. 身份验证协议: PAP, MS-CHAPv1(也就是MD4), MS-CHAPv2, GTC. 常见的就这些.3. 通过Rad...
分类:
Windows程序 时间:
2015-09-09 16:35:30
阅读次数:
1166
//Go标准包中只有MD5的实现
//还好,github上有MD4实现。
package?main
import?(
????"golang.org/x/crypto/md4"
????"encoding/hex"
????"fmt"
)
func?get_md4(buf?[]byte)?([]?byte)?{
...
分类:
其他好文 时间:
2015-08-30 23:41:18
阅读次数:
430
1. MD5算法是一种散列(hash)算法(摘要算法,指纹算法),不是一种加密算法(易错)。任何长度的任意内容都可以用MD5计算出散列值。MD5的前身:MD2、MD3、MD4。介绍工具:CalcMD5.zip。主要作用就是【验明"真身"】,字符串文件均可(确保信息传输过程中的完整性、一致性)。 2....
分类:
编程语言 时间:
2015-08-04 19:06:14
阅读次数:
150